7 Best Vegan Supplements for Weight Loss

As veganism continues to gain popularity, many people are turning to plant-based diets for ethical reasons and health benefits, including weight loss. However, a vegan diet may sometimes lack nutrients essential for optimal health and weight management. This is where vegan supplements come in. This article explores the best vegan supplements for weight loss, ensuring you stay healthy and energized while shedding those extra pounds.

1. Protein Powders

Why It’s Important:

Protein plays a crucial role in building and maintaining muscle mass, which, in turn, helps increase metabolism and burn fat. Getting sufficient protein from food alone can be challenging for vegans, particularly during a weight loss phase.

Best Options:

  • Pea Protein: Known for being highly digestible and rich in iron, pea protein can support muscle recovery and growth.
  • Hemp Protein: This protein contains all nine essential amino acids and is also r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which are beneficial for cardiovascular health.
  • Soy Protein: As a complete protein, soy protein is comparable to animal proteins, making it an excellent option for muscle building and fat loss.

How to Use:

2. Omega-3 Fatty Acids

Omega-3 fatty acids, particularly EPA and DHA, significantly reduce inflammation, support heart health, and promote fat loss. However, vegans might miss out on these essential fats, as they are primarily found in fish.

Best Options:

  • Algal Oil: A sustainable, plant-based source of EPA and DHA derived from algae, making it a vegan-friendly option.
  • Flaxseed Oil: Rich in ALA (omega-3), it is an excellent addition to a vegan diet. However, it’s less efficacious than EPA and DHA for weight loss.

How to Use:

Take a daily algal oil supplement to ensure adequate omega-3s, or add flaxseed oil to salads and smoothies for an extra boost.

3. B12 Supplements

Why It’s Important:

Vitamin B12 is crucial for energy production, cognitive function, and the creation of red blood cells. Since it’s primarily found in animal products, vegans need to supplement this nutrient to avoid deficiency, which can lead to fatigue and hinder weight loss efforts.

Best Options:

  • Methylcobalamin: This form of B12 is highly absorbable and particularly suited for vegans.
  • Cyanocobalamin: Another effective form of B12, commonly found in vegan supplements.

How to Use:

Take a daily B12 supplement as the label recommends, or opt for a B12-fortified nutritional yeast to sprinkle on your meals.

4. Iron Supplements

Why It’s Important:

Iron is essential for transporting oxygen throughout the body and sustaining energy levels. A deficiency can lead to fatigue, making staying active and supporting weight loss challenging. Vegans are at a higher risk of iron deficiency since plant-based sources of iron are less easily absorbed by the body.

Best Options:

  • Ferrous Bisglycinate is a form of iron that’s gentle on the stomach and highly absorbable.
  • Spirulina: A natural source of iron that also provides other nutrients.

How to Use:

Pair iron supplements with vitamin C-rich foods (like citrus fruits) to enhance absorption. Be mindful of the dosage to avoid potential side effects from excess iron.

5. L-Carnitine

Why It’s Important:

L-carnitine is an amino acid that assists in energy production by transporting fatty acids into the mitochondria, which are converted into energy. This process can enhance fat burning, especially during exercise.

Best Options:

  • L-Carnitine Tartrate: A popular form of L-Carnitine, often used to support fat loss and exercise performance.
  • Acetyl-L-Carnitine: This form is also beneficial for brain health and cognitive function.

How to Use:

Take L-carnitine supplements before your workout to enhance energy and promote fat burning. Be sure to follow the recommended dosage instructions on the supplement label.

6. Green Tea Extract

Why It’s Important:

Green tea extract is rich in catechins, antioxidants that have been shown to support fat-burning and boost metabolism. The caffeine content in green tea also provides an additional metabolic boost.

Best Options:

  • EGCG (Epigallocatechin Gallate): The most potent catechin found in green tea, EGCG is responsible for many fat-burning effects.

How to Use:

Take a green tea extract supplement before meals to enhance fat burning. Alternatively, enjoy a few cups of green tea throughout the day.

7. Fiber Supplements

Why It’s Important:

Fiber is vital for weight loss because it promotes a feeling of fullness, reduces overall calorie intake, and supports healthy digestion. Vegans who don’t consume enough high-fiber foods may benefit from a supplement.

Best Options:

  • Psyllium Husk: A soluble fiber that helps regulate digestion and can promote a feeling of fullness.
  • Inulin: A prebiotic fiber that supports gut health and helps control appetite.

How to Use:

Add fiber supplements to your diet gradually to avoid digestive discomfort. Drink plenty of water to ensure the fiber works effectively.
